First time here. We were on our way up north and stopped in for a hot beverage. It’s part of a small strip mall on the west side, with a few metal café tables for outdoor seating. Inside is a large area with plenty of seating, plus some additional rooms for groups to meet. We received a friendly greeting and helpful service at the counter. I ordered my usual London Fog (little lavender, little vanilla, extra foam), and they did a great job preparing it. I also ordered a Cranberry Orange Scone, which they warmed up. After a few minutes (to allow the tea to steep), both items were ready. The London Fog was excellent — flavorful, balanced, and not overly sweet. The scone, however, was disappointing; though warmed, it tasted dry and stale. Two other issues detracted from the visit. Much of the furniture looked worn and past its prime, and there were flies throughout the space that were a constant distraction. Overall, the experience was underwhelming. While the beverage was very good, the food quality and atmosphere would keep us from recommending or returning.

Don't let the strip mall exterior detract you. The inside is a cozy place with a little bit of modern country house vibe to it. I ordered a medium mocha, no whip and whole milk plus a sourdough breakfast sandwich with bacon and american cheese. I usually order a quad americano but will get a mocha if I am trying a new place since the sweetness can slightly redeem a poor bean, grind, machine or barista. After ordering and paying with Apple Pay I was happy to see they use Colectivo beans so I knew at least the bean would be good and fresh. The barista seemed very knowledgeable as she was helping out a newbie espresso drinker at the time I was ordering (she may have been one of the female owners actually). My food and drink was brought to me with a smiling face which is something that usually doesn't happen in the big Madison cafes. The drink was well made and the breakfast sandwich was surprisingly large. They hit all the bases on the sandwich as far as the eggs and bacon were cooked well and the cheese was melted all the way through. If I had to criticize them on one thing I would say the level of salt was on the high side. It might have been from the bacon though.
